Explanation:

Two angles are supplementary to each other if the sum of the angles is 180 degrees.

Given that one angle is 5 degrees. Let x be the angle supplementary to this angle. Hence, we have


x+5=180^(\circ)

Subtract 5 to both sides of the equation


x=180-5\\\\x=175^(\circ)

Hence, the angle 175 degrees is supplementary to angle 5.
